(13.2%)

Net sales

Despite a decrease in sales year on year, we are tracing a recovery trend toward growth, owing to increased advertising in terms of quality and quantity

Advertising effectiveness improved as the impact of pirate sites diminished

Operating profit

Increase in advertising expenses driven by up-front investments in line with plan
